
Platform Capabilities
All-Terrain Performance
Max speed 3.7 m/s, 40° slope climbing, continuous stair climb ≤16 cm, 8 kg payload capacity for demanding inspection environments.
All-Weather Capability
IP54 protection rating with operating temperature range 0°C to 40°C, ensuring reliable performance in rain, dust, and variable conditions.
Fall-Resistant Design
High robustness with strong anti-fall stability, millisecond-level self-recovery from falls, and reinforced frame with 360° body protection.
Open Platform Architecture
Multiple expansion interfaces (Ethernet, USB, SBUS, UART, Power) enable integration of custom payloads, sensors, and communication modules.

How to Choose the Right ZSL Series Robot for Your Application
The ZSL series offers two distinct configurations for buyers evaluating a quadruped robot for industrial inspection: the ZSL-1 pure-legged platform and the ZSL-1W wheel-legged hybrid. Selecting the right model depends primarily on your operational range requirements and terrain profile.
If your application involves indoor inspection in confined spaces — such as server rooms, manufacturing floors, or multi-story buildings — the ZSL-1’s compact 15 kg frame and 40° slope capability make it the preferred choice. For buyers looking to buy an inspection robot for outdoor substation patrol or campus security, the ZSL-1W’s 9 km range on a single charge and wheel-assisted locomotion significantly reduces per-inspection energy cost.

The ZSL-1 offers 1–2 hours of operational duration on a single 4.6 Ah battery charge, covering approximately 6 km with a standard payload. The ZSL-1W extends this to 9 km range with its 5 Ah / 43.2 V battery. Actual duration varies based on terrain, payload weight, and gait speed selection.
Both the ZSL-1 and ZSL-1W carry an IP54 protection rating, providing protection against dust ingress and water splashing from any direction. This makes them suitable for light outdoor environments, light rain, and dusty industrial settings. For applications requiring full immersion protection (IP67), the ZSM-1 platform is recommended.
The ZSL-1 supports a recommended payload of approximately 8 kg, with a structural limit of approximately 10 kg. The ZSL-1W supports 10 kg recommended / 12 kg limit. Payloads exceeding the recommended weight may reduce operational duration and agility performance.
Yes. The ZSL series is designed for stair climbing with a maximum step height of 16 cm and slope climbing capability of 30° (standard) to 40° (extreme). The robot can navigate continuous staircase environments autonomously as part of a pre-programmed inspection route.
The ZSL series features an open platform architecture with Ethernet, USB, SBUS, UART, and Power expansion interfaces. Compatible payloads include thermal imaging cameras, visible-light cameras, gas detection sensors, LiDAR modules, and custom communication systems. The ZSL-1 and ZSL-1W operate in environments from 0°C to 40°C. For applications in extreme cold environments (below 0°C), the ZSM-1 platform with its extended operating range of -20°C to 50°C is recommended.
